What Roof Repair Costs in Tampa

Let’s put real numbers on it. A minor repair like re-sealing a pipe boot or replacing a rusted vent collar runs $450 to $850 in Tampa. Flashing rehab around a chimney or roof-to-wall intersection typically lands between $900 and $2,200, depending on how much corroded metal we have to pull and whether the underlying decking is still sound. Replacing a section of damaged shingle roof runs $1,500 to $3,800 for a typical Tampa ranch on a CBS block home. If your repair touches an opening, like the Seminole Heights scenario where a rotted window buck met a rusted roof vent, you’re looking at $2,500 to $5,000 because the window itself has to be brought up to Florida Product Approval standards. Whole-home roof replacements in Tampa run $18,000 to $35,000+ depending on square footage and whether you’re in a designated historic district like Hyde Park or Ybor City, where the Architectural Review Commission restricts materials.

What moves the price in Tampa specifically? Proximity to the bay. Homes within a mile of Tampa Bay need hot-dip galvanized or 316 stainless fasteners, marine-grade polyether sealants, and impact-rated underlayment that costs 20 to 35 percent more than what a contractor from Lakeland or Ocala might quote you. We don’t cut that corner, because we’ve torn apart too many roofs where the previous contractor used electroplated fasteners that corroded to rust dust in under three years. Our Roof Repair Services in Tampa

Flashing and Sealant Rehab Around Roof Penetrations

This is the repair we do most often in Tampa, because salt air eats standard flashing faster here than almost anywhere in Florida. Chimneys, vent pipes, HVAC curbs, and skylights all create penetrations where water finds a way in. We remove corroded flashing and re-seal with marine-grade polyether sealant that flexes with Tampa’s heat-and-humidity cycles without cracking. We also replace the fasteners with hot-dip galvanized or 316 stainless, because the electroplated zinc screws most contractors use will rust to dust within three years of exposure to Tampa Bay’s salt fog.

Replacement of Corroded Anchor Bolts, Pipe Boots, and Edge Metal

Edge metal, drip edges, pipe boots, and anchor bolts are the sacrificial parts of a Tampa roof. We see them rusted through on homes all over South Tampa and Carrollwood, especially within a mile of the bay. We replace them with 316 stainless or hot-dip galvanized components that carry a marine-grade corrosion specification. The price difference is real, maybe $150 to $400 more per repair, but the alternative is redoing the same repair in three years at double the cost because the decking has now rotted too.

Roof-to-Wall Water Intrusion Repair

When wind-driven rain gets behind the fascia and runs into the soffit-to-rafter connection, the culprit is often a corroded jamb flange on an existing non-impact aluminum window. We rebuild the rotted wood buck, re-flash the transition with marine-grade sealant, and install an impact-rated replacement that meets Florida Product Approval. This is the repair pattern we see in Seminole Heights and East Lake-Orient Park, where the original windows are decades old and the roof sheathing has been quietly wicking moisture for years.

Common Roof Repair Problems We See in Tampa Homes

  • Rust-stained roof cement and popped shingle tabs around penetrations. Contractors used electroplated fasteners within a mile of Tampa Bay, and salt fog corroded the zinc plating in under three years. We replace them with hot-dip galvanized or 316 stainless and re-seal with marine-grade polyether.
  • Water intrusion at roof-to-wall intersections. Existing non-impact aluminum windows have corroded jamb flanges, letting wind-driven rain run behind the fascia and into soffit-to-rafter connections. We rebuild the wood buck and re-flash the transition.
  • Granule loss and blisters on low-slope modified-bitumen roofs. Near-tropical humidity keeps trapped moisture from flashing details from ever fully drying, accelerating membrane failure at curb-mounted HVAC units in South Tampa. We strip the blistered membrane and re-apply with proper ventilation and drainage.
  • Rotted wood bucks around original openings in pre-1950 bungalows. Seminole Heights and Ybor City homes often have wood double-hung windows with fully rotted frames hidden behind intact-looking trim. The roof leak is the symptom; the rotted buck is the disease.

Why Salt Air Decides Your Tampa Roof Repair, Not Just the Schedule

Here’s what we actually see on Tampa roofs, and it’s different from what a contractor from inland Central Florida would tell you. Rust-stained roof cement around chimneys within two years of a “new” roof. Popped shingle tabs where the fasteners have corroded to dust. Edge metal that flakes apart when you touch it. Blistered modified-bitumen on low-slope roofs where tropical humidity never lets trapped moisture dry out. These are salt-air and humidity failures, and they happen faster in Tampa than in Orlando or Lakeland because the city sits at the head of a large, shallow bay that funnels salt fog across the peninsula.

The cheap spec version of a Tampa roof repair uses electroplated fasteners, standard polyurethane caulk, and flashing rated for inland use. It costs 20 to 35 percent less than the coastal-spec version. But within a decade, sometimes within three years, the fasteners have rusted through, the caulk has cracked, and the flashing has corroded enough to let water behind the fascia. Now you’re not redoing a $600 pipe boot, you’re replacing rotted decking and rebuilding a soffit-to-rafter connection for $7,000. The coastal spec costs more the day you pay for it, and less every year after. Florida Pays You Back

Tampa homeowners who upgrade to impact-rated windows and doors during a roof repair may qualify for several incentives. The My Safe Florida Home program offers matching grants up to $10,000 for qualifying wind-mitigation upgrades. Florida provides a sales-tax exemption on impact-resistant windows and doors. The federal 25C energy credit covers 30 percent of product cost, up to $600 per year on qualifying units. And after a wind-mitigation inspection, which typically costs $75 to $150, many carriers apply a windstorm-premium credit averaging around 25 percent on the windstorm portion of your policy. We don’t guarantee any of these programs, because the state and your carrier set the final numbers, but we’ll walk you through which of our roof and opening repairs typically qualify.
